Skip to content

Instantly share code, notes, and snippets.

@Trass3r
Last active January 25, 2020 01:35
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save Trass3r/81c4d698db53def08142d3c103030ac7 to your computer and use it in GitHub Desktop.
Save Trass3r/81c4d698db53def08142d3c103030ac7 to your computer and use it in GitHub Desktop.
for %f in (src/*.cpp) do clang-tidy -p buildNinja --config="{Checks: '-*,modernize-use-default-member-init', CheckOptions: [{key: UseAssignment, value: 1}]}" --header-filter=src src\%f --fix-errors
for %f in (src/*.cpp) do clang-tidy -p buildNinja --config="{Checks: '-*,cppcoreguidelines-pro-type-member-init', CheckOptions: [{key: UseAssignment, value: 1}, {key: IgnoreArrays, value: 1}]}" --header-filter=src src\%f --fix-errors
for %f in (src/*.cpp) do clang-tidy -p buildNinja --checks=-*,modernize-loop-convert --header-filter=src src\%f --fix-errors
for %f in (src/*.cpp) do clang-tidy -p buildNinja --config="{Checks: '-*,modernize-use-override', CheckOptions: [{key: IgnoreDestructors, value: 1}]}" --header-filter=src src\%f --fix-errors
# redundant casts
"C:\Program Files\Git\usr\bin\find.exe" src -name "*.cpp" | "C:\Program Files\Git\usr\bin\xargs.exe" clang-tidy -p buildNinja --checks=-*,google-readability-casting --header-filter=src --export-fixes=casts.yml
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ment